.categories-inner .swiper-wrapper{display:flex;align-items:center}.w1{width:100%}.category-item{width:300px}.category-item__image{padding-bottom:100%;position:relative}.category-item__image img{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;z-index:1;opacity:0}.category-item__image:after{content:"";display:block;position:absolute;top:0;left:0;width:100%;height:100%;background:var(--section-overlay-color, #000);opacity:var(--section-overlay-opacity, .4);z-index:1}.category-item__image img.lazyloaded{animation:fade-in 1s cubic-bezier(.26,.54,.32,1) 0s forwards;transition:none}.category-item__overlay-link,.category-item__content{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.category-item__content{display:flex;align-items:center;justify-content:center;text-align:center}.category-item__content-inner{width:100%}.category-item__subtitle,.category-item__title,.category-item__detail{color:#fff}.category-item__title{margin-bottom:10px}.category-item__content .btn,.category-item__content .btn:hover,.category-item__content .btn:focus{background:var(--section-button-color, #003282)}.category-item:hover .btn:after{animation:shine .75s cubic-bezier(.01,.56,1,1)}.categories-slider__arrow{padding:10px;border-radius:50%;position:absolute;z-index:1;background:#ffffffb5;transition:.2s opacity;opacity:1}.categories-slider__arrow.swiper-button-disabled{opacity:0}.categories-slider__arrow svg{display:block;width:20px;height:20px}.categories-slider__arrow__left{left:15px}.categories-slider__arrow__left svg{transform:rotate(90deg)}.categories-slider__arrow__right{right:15px}.categories-slider__arrow__right svg{transform:rotate(-90deg)}.categories-slider__pagination{display:none}.category-item--stacked .category-item__subtitle,.category-item--stacked .category-item__title,.category-item--stacked .category-item__detail{color:var(--colorTextBody)}.category-item--stacked .category-item__content{position:relative;top:auto;left:auto;height:auto;padding:20px}@media only screen and (min-width: 769px){.categories-inner{padding:0 20px 40px}.categories-slider__arrow{padding:15px}.categories-slider__arrow__left{left:30px}.categories-slider__arrow__right{right:30px}.categories-slider__pagination{display:flex;justify-content:center;align-items:center;gap:10px}.categories-slider__pagination .swiper-pagination-bullet-active{opacity:1}}
/*# sourceMappingURL=/cdn/shop/t/93/assets/component-categories-wrapper.css.map?v=113418295154567026731708544022 */
